Harnessing the Power of a Greener Future: Unveiling the Environmental Benefits of Renewable Energy

Posted on May 21, 2025 By Dante No Comments on Harnessing the Power of a Greener Future: Unveiling the Environmental Benefits of Renewable Energy

As the world grapples with the challenges of climate change, air pollution, and sustainable development, the role of renewable energy has never been more crucial. Renewable energy, derived from natural sources such as sunlight, wind, rain, and geothermal heat, offers a cleaner, more sustainable alternative to fossil fuels. In this article, we’ll delve into the environmental benefits of renewable energy, exploring how it can help mitigate climate change, improve air and water quality, and preserve natural resources.

A Cleaner Air to Breathe

One of the most significant environmental benefits of renewable energy is its impact on air quality. Unlike fossil fuels, which release pollutants like carbon dioxide, sulfur dioxide, and nitrogen oxides into the atmosphere, renewable energy sources produce little to no greenhouse gases or air pollutants. Solar energy, for instance, generates electricity without any emissions, while wind energy produces only a fraction of the emissions of traditional fossil fuel-based power plants. By transitioning to renewable energy, we can significantly reduce air pollution, improving public health and quality of life.

Water Conservation

Renewable energy also offers a significant advantage in terms of water conservation. Traditional power plants, especially those that use coal or natural gas, require massive amounts of water for cooling, which can strain local water resources. In contrast, most renewable energy sources require minimal water inputs. Solar panels, for example, use only rainwater for cleaning, while wind turbines don’t require any water at all. By switching to renewable energy, we can reduce our water footprint, alleviate pressure on water resources, and ensure a more sustainable future.

Reducing Climate Change

Perhaps the most pressing environmental benefit of renewable energy is its ability to mitigate climate change. Fossil fuels, the primary driver of climate change, account for over 65% of human-caused greenhouse gas emissions. Renewable energy, on the other hand, emits significantly less greenhouse gases, making it an essential tool in our fight against climate change. By transitioning to renewable energy, we can reduce our carbon footprint, slow global warming, and preserve the planet for future generations.
